A/C System not cold while stopped
 
So i have tried mutliple searches with no results.

I assume the cooling fan is out and that is why the A/C is not working while stopped at lights, etc. As soon as we start to move the A/C kicks in and is cold as ever. The dealer we just purchased it from said they will take care of it, but I am curious if its a well known issue?

Again i assume its the cooling fan sensor or relay that turns the fan on, and that is somehow not functioning (fuse?), or whatnot.

Anyone experience similar problem?

2006 M3 Hatch.

RE: A/C System not cold while stopped
 
If the cooling fan was out the car itself would be running hot at the same time, I don't know if it has a separate relay for the A/C but it might be a little low on Freon and just needs the extra air running across the condenser to make it cold.

RE: A/C System not cold while stopped
 
On my M3, the AC air is certainly cooler while the car is in motion, versus stopped and idling. I think this is true for any car, the engine is revving higher, air is being pushed through the front grill by the speed of the car, both of which help the AC system.

I believe Mazda has made some changes to the M3's ACsystem over time, from what I have read, it was pretty weak the first year or two of the M3s production (2004 and 2005).

I know the AC system does have a shut off switch, it will cut off if it senses the engine is getting too hot. I assume your dealer, as part of the process,is going to test to see if this switch is functioning properly.
